1 large slice of hearty white bread, such as a rustic bouleHeat a toaster oven on broil for five minutes. Place the bread on a pan and toast until nicely browned. Apply spread, then the Swiss cheese, then the meat dressed with more of the piquant spread, followed by the tomato slices and topped with the grated cheese. Return to the oven for about 5 minute more, until cheese is melted and browned. Variations: top with parmesan cheese, replace the Swiss cheese with another mild cheese, substitute a horseradish spread for the mustard, use a tangy herb cheese in place of the Swiss, use other meats such as turkey or pork. Serves 1 or 2.
1 oz Swiss cheese, sliced
3 oz chicken, sliced thin (boiled, roast, or deli slices)
1 oz ripe tomato, thinly sliced
1 oz grated cheddar cheese
2 T piquant mustard
